Some new features are going live this morning. It may take a couple days for them to propagate across all accounts, but we wanted to go ahead and let you know what to expect:
- Inbox Inspections are now free (yes, free) for customers on our monthly plans
- SMS security alerts: We’ll send you a TXT message whenever there’s a login, list download, API key generated, or some other trigger, within your account
- Detect new login location: You can force your account security question whenever we detect a login from a new IP address
- Two-factor authentication: We’re offering a free 2-factor authentication service so you can add an extra layer of protection to your account.
